Samaritans Medical Malpractice-Statutes

 

See Va. Code § 8.01-225 as to exemption from liability of persons rendering emergency care.

Samaritans Medical Malpractice-Cases

1980 Penn v. Manns, 221 Va. 88, 267 S.E.2d 126.

Defendant was rushing plaintiff’s decedent to hospital when involved in accident. Good samaritan immunity not applicable.
